**Mgmt Meeting Minutes — Retiring the Brightline Range**

Quick recap for sales leads at Fenholt Supplies: we agreed to retire the Brightline fixture range by year-end. Remaining stock moves to clearance pricing next month, and accounts on standing orders get migrated to the Lumetta range. Trade-in incentives were approved in principle. The confidential note on next steps sits just below.

board note of bajof-bajeg: The pricing group signed off on a budget of $13.4 million for Project Sildor. The renewal with Lamixek Holdings closes at $48.9 million a year, 49 percent above the last contract.

CI note — Bramblekit image slimming, for security review. We moved the runtime image to a distroless base and stripped the package manager, shells, and build toolchain. Vulnerability scan count dropped from 214 to 9, all low severity. No setuid binaries remain. Please verify the SBOM diff matches before approving. The scanned image's build token appears directly below.

pipeline stamp: htk31_f769b577b3028a4e9958e5bb8d1259a

**Q: Why are we moving cron jobs into the Quillway workflow engine?**

A: Plain cron on the scheduler hosts gives us no retries, no dependency ordering, and no visibility when a job silently fails. Quillway provides all three, plus centralized logging. The migration is happening in waves: reporting jobs first, then billing, then cleanup tasks. During a wave, the cron entry stays in place but disabled, so rollback is one line. Wave schedules, per-job owners, and the cutover checklist for the eng sync are tracked here:

wiki page, tahaf-tajog: https://jira.ordindyn.corp/pipeline

Subject: Quickstore 4.2 — bloom filter now fronts the KV layer

Plugin authors: starting with this release, Quickstore places a bloom filter ahead of the key-value store. Negative lookups return faster; false positives fall through safely. No API changes are required on your side. Verify your plugin against the staging build referenced below.

session token of fahif-tadup = htk3_9c7